When the Kansas City Current capped off their record-breaking season by lifting the NWSL Shield last year, team captain Lo’eau LaBonta joked to then-head coach Vlatko Andonovski that he was her longest-tenured manager. The midfielder, who has been with the club since it entered the league in 2021, had seen a new coach each year until Andonovski was hired in October 2023 after stepping down as head of the U.S. women’s national team.
